Relatively little is known about the correspondence of William Burnside, a pioneer of group theory in the UK. There are only a few dozen extant letters from or to him, though they are not without interest. However, one of the most noteworthy letters to or at least about him, in that it had a special mention in his obituary in the ‘Proceedings of the Royal Society’, has not been positively identified. It’s not clear who it was from or when it was sent. We’ll look at some possibilities.
